Output b5bb465abb02d818fc3ddfc83da41593d6ea8081fa362d5aacf2e6d2a5d68895:8

value
1328258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db109da0bf073856a57a7f859150089d36377193 OP_EQUAL
address
3MfKp33Yh9yMExvyXip6HhbCFg7ogJzo4e
transaction
b5bb465abb02d818fc3ddfc83da41593d6ea8081fa362d5aacf2e6d2a5d68895
spent
true